Two more schools experienced exposures Monday according to Island Health.

Island Health has added two Greater Victoria schools to their COVID-19 exposure list.

Colquitz Middle School — located on Dumeresq Street — and Tillicum Community School — located on Albina Street — recorded COVID-19 exposures on June 14, 2021.

Greater Victoria School District 61 (SD61) said on Twitter notification letters have been sent out to the school community.

SD61 says anyone who may have been exposed will be contacted by Island Health directly.

An exposure is defined by Island Health as a single person with a lab-confirmed COVID-19 infection who attended school during their infectious period.

Island Health says a child can continue to attend school if a parent or guardian does not receive a phone call or letter from public health.

Should a parent or guardian see a notification on Island Health’s school exposure site, it does not necessarily mean their child has been exposed to COVID-19.
